Exactly how to Plan for Settlements with Potential Purchasers in Atlanta

Bargaining with potential purchasers is a critical action in marketing any service, specifically in a dynamic market like Atlanta. With its prospering economic situation and dynamic business spirit, Atlanta supplies significant chances for vendors. Nonetheless, to take full advantage of worth and ensure a successful sale, prep work is vital. Below's a extensive guide to assist you plan for negotiations with potential purchasers in Atlanta.

1. Comprehend the Atlanta Market

Prior to getting in arrangements, it's essential to have a solid understanding of Atlanta's company landscape. The city is home to a diverse variety of sectors, consisting of modern technology, logistics, movie, healthcare, and real estate. Here's exactly how to prepare:

Conduct Marketing Research: Explore market fads relevant to your industry in Atlanta. Understanding whether your sector is experiencing growth, stability, or decline can help set reasonable expectations.

Evaluate Comparable Sales: Take a look at recent transactions of businesses similar to yours in Atlanta. This will provide understanding right into rates standards and customer assumptions.

Think About Resident Economic Elements: Elements such as population growth, tax incentives, and framework growths can influence your service's appraisal and purchaser interest.

2. Prepare Your Financials

Accurate and clear monetary records are essential during arrangements. Customers will certainly scrutinize every detail to analyze the feasibility of your company. Here's just how to prepare:

Arrange Financial Papers: Ensure you have current earnings and loss declarations, balance sheets, tax returns, and capital statements for the past 3-5 years.

Highlight Key Metrics: Recognize and showcase metrics such as revenue development, revenue margins, customer procurement expenses, and recurring earnings streams.

Conduct a Financial Audit: Think about hiring an independent auditor to validate your financials. This adds reliability and comforts purchasers of the business's wellness.

3. Establish a Clear Evaluation

Figuring out the value of your service is one of one of the most crucial actions. An accurate evaluation ensures you're bargaining from a setting of toughness.

Use Specialist Appraisal Providers: Deal with a organization broker or appraisal specialist acquainted with Atlanta's market to determine a fair and affordable price.

Understand Assessment Methods: Familiarize on your own with common assessment approaches, such as asset-based, income-based, and market-based methods.

Highlight Intangible Properties: Showcase elements like brand name credibility, client commitment, intellectual property, and strategic place in Atlanta to improve regarded value.

4. Determine Your Perfect Buyer

Not all purchasers coincide, and recognizing their motivations can influence settlement approaches.

Strategic Buyers: These purchasers look for harmonies with their existing organizations. Highlight growth capacity and calculated benefits your organization offers.

Financial Buyers: These purchasers concentrate on ROI. Stress solid capital, stable profits, and growth chances.

Local vs. National Buyers: Purchasers based in Atlanta may value regional links and market understandings, while nationwide customers might focus on scalability.

5. Prepare a Strong Confidential Information Memorandum (CIM).

A CIM is a detailed record that gives potential buyers with key details concerning your company. It works as a foundation for settlements.

Consist Of Essential Information: Cover areas such as organization background, functional framework, products/services, economic efficiency, and market position.

Maintain Confidentiality: Share sensitive details just after get more info safeguarding non-disclosure agreements (NDAs).

Tailor the Discussion: Highlight aspects of your company that line up with the purchaser's goals.

6. Construct a Group of Advisors.

Offering a service is a intricate procedure, and having the right team of professionals can significantly enhance your arrangement placement.

Service Broker: A broker with experience in Atlanta's market can link you with qualified customers and take care of the sale process.

Attorney: Hire a legal expert concentrating on organization deals to draft contracts and make certain conformity with local regulations.

Accounting professional: An accounting professional can offer economic understandings, help with tax preparation, and guarantee accurate coverage.

Appraisal Expert: Their expertise will certainly assist justify your asking price throughout negotiations.

7. Create a Settlement Strategy.

A well-balanced negotiation approach will aid you preserve control and achieve positive terms.

Set Clear Purposes: Determine your top priorities, such as cost, settlement terms, and shift timeline.

Recognize Non-Negotiables: Know which terms you are unwilling to endanger on.

Understand Purchaser Motivations: Study the buyer's history and goals to customize your approach.

Exercise Energetic Paying Attention: Listen to the customer's concerns and resolve them constructively.

8. Address Legal and Conformity Demands.

Atlanta's governing landscape may include specific lawful requirements for offering a business.

Evaluation Organization Licenses: Ensure all licenses and licenses are up-to-date and transferable.

Address Impressive Responsibilities: Deal with any kind of pending lawsuits, tax problems, or financial institution obligations.

Abide By Work Laws: If the sale impacts workers, make certain compliance with labor legislations and supply essential notifications.

9. Plan for Due Diligence.

Due persistance is a essential phase where buyers confirm the details you have actually provided. Proper preparation will enhance the procedure and construct buyer confidence.

Organize Paperwork: Create a online information area with all pertinent documents, including financials, contracts, leases, and intellectual property records.

Be Transparent: Address any type of prospective warnings proactively. Sincerity promotes depend on and protects against future disagreements.

Plan for Inquiries: Prepare for customer questions and have actually described solutions all set.

10. Plan For Post-Sale Change.

Customers might need your help throughout the shift period to guarantee a smooth handover.

Describe Shift Plans: Define the duration and extent of your participation post-sale.

Train Followers: Supply training and support to the new owner or management group.

Connect with Stakeholders: Educate workers, clients, and providers about the transition to keep partnerships.

11. Anticipate Common Difficulties.

Settlements rarely go totally efficiently, however being prepared can help you navigate obstacles successfully.

Cost Disagreements: Utilize your assessment analysis to justify your asking rate.

Privacy Issues: Use NDAs and restriction info sharing to major customers.

Purchaser Financing Issues: Validate the purchaser's financial capacity early at the same time.

Emotional Decision-Making: Keep goal and focus on your lasting goals.

12. Exercise Persistence and Flexibility.

Arrangements can take some time, and it's important to continue to be patient and versatile.

Avoid Rushing: Take the time to review offers extensively and work out terms that align with your goals.

Be Open to Compromise: While preserving your priorities, want to make concessions to reach a mutually beneficial contract.
